A molecular journey : tales of sublimating ices from hot cores to comets
The thesis explores how interstellar chemistry evolves as a function of time and changing physical architectures during the formation of stars.

Liposomes as delivery system for allergen-specific immunotherapy
In this book liposomes are explored as delivery system for allergen-specific immunotherapy. Both cationic and anionic formulations are prepared with Bet v 1, one of the allergens in birch pollen.

Chemical synthesis of fragments of galactosaminogalactan and pel polysaccharides
The work described in this Thesis is focused on the assembly of oligosaccharide fragments derived from a fungal polysaccharide, galactosaminogalactan (GAG) and fragments of the exopolysaccharide Pel, generated by Pseudomonas aeruginosa.

ERC Starting Grant for Roxanne Kieltyka: stem cells in gels
Chemist Roxanne Kieltyka has received an ERC Starting Grant of 2 million euros. In her lab, she creates gels that mimic the instructive material that supports cells in our body. With the grant, she aims to make these gels stiff and tough, and to create a bio-printed miniature heart ventricle.

The immune system in action against cervical cancer
In the hunt for a vaccine against cervical cancer, fundamental knowledge about the immune system and organic chemistry have been brought together and have already resulted in a vaccine that is now being tested in clinical trials. Scientists are now working hard on an improved variant.
